#fe0692 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#fe0692 is composed of 99.6% red, 2.4% green and 57.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 97.6% magenta, 42.5%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 326.1 degrees, a saturation of 99.2% and a lightness of 51%. #fe0692 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ff0cff with #fd0025. Closest websafe color is: #ff0099.

Shades and Tints of #fe0692
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050003 is the darkest color, while #fff0f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#fe0692
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8b7983 is the less saturated color, while #fe0692 is the most saturated one.
